I am looking for a new chainsaw as my Sachs-Dolmar 116SI just died according to my local repair shop which also mentioned that getting new parts for it would be next to impossible and expensive if they could find them.
I dont know much about chainsaws other than basic maintenance. I had my Sachs for 12+ years and my dad used it hard for ~8 yrs or more before that. My usage is firewood; 4-6 cords year and other misc use.
The saws I am considering (and seem comparable to my old Sachs) are:
Stihl MS310
Stihl MS390
Stihl MS361
Husky 359
Husky 365
My local repair shop is a Stihl dealer, so I am leaning that way, but am a bit confused between the Pro line and the Home Owner/MidRange line of Stihl saws. Is there a true difference?
I really want something that will last the 20+ years like the Sachs did. I appreciate any advice.
